■ Function Keys on the bottom of the Main Screen

[RXPLAY] (F1)

{page 13-7}

Press to open the Recording Audio Files screen.
[TXMSG] (F2)

{page 13-1}

Press in other than CW, FSK and PSK modes to open

the Voice Message screen.

[KEYER] (F2)

{page 5-21}

Press in CW mode to open the CW Message screen.
[DECODE] (F3)

{page 5-35}

Appears while in FSK or PSK mode. This key does not

appear while in other operating modes.

[TONE] (F4)

{page 5-31}

Appears while in FM mode. This key does not appear

while in other operating modes.

[SCAN] (F5)

{page 11-1}

Press to start scanning.
[M V] (F6)

{page 10-6}

Appears while in the memory channel mode or quick

memory channel mode. This key does not appear

while in other operating modes. Press to activate the

memory shift.

[M.LIST] (F7)

{page 10-1}

Press to open the Memory Channel List screen.

COOLING FAN AND TEMPERATURE PROTECTION FOR

FINAL UNIT

To protect internal circuits from high temperatures, the

transceiver senses the temperature of the final unit

regardless of the operation state, either transmitting or

receiving, and controls the cooling fan rotation speed for

the final unit and the transmit power as described below.

If a thermistor detects a temperature increase in the final

unit, the cooling fan at first starts rotating at low speed. If

the temperature increases further, the cooling fan rotates

at high speed.

If excessively high temperature is detected, the transmit

power is limited until the internal temperature cools down.

Note:

◆ If a message notifies you of a detected high temperature, do not

shut down the transceiver with a press down of the main I/O power

switch to the "O" position.

◆ If the main power (I/O) is shut down, the cooling fan stops, and it

may take longer until the transceiver cools down.

MAIN AND SUB SCREEN DISPLAYS

In the main display, the bandscope, waterfall and audio

scope in addition to the meter display can be displayed.

A dial, the audio FFT scope (the bandpass spectrum

frequency display) and the

F value can be displayed on

the sub screen.

MAIN SCREEN

After the startup screen that appears when turning the

transceiver power ( ) ON disappears, the same display

was retained when the transceiver power ( ) was turned

OFF last time appears.

In this case, pressing [MENU] or [EXTEND] (F) while

[EXTEND] (F) is in the key guide compresses the displays

to be the compressed mode screen.

As explained below, the function keys located below and

right side of the main screen can activate key tasks and

change the display for configuration.

Press [ESC] while a screen is open to close the screen

and revert to the normal operating screen.
